How do I import MP3 files in Music Maker MX?

wt_watch wrote on 3/15/2012, 11:14 PM

When I load mp3 arrangements the tracks disappear and I can't do a thing unless I close the program and reopen. But then I still can't load mp3. I downloaded mp3 enabler codex and it's the same. I even removed MMMX and reinstalled it!

I used to have Music Maker 12 and I could load anything I wanted including MIDI files!

Even at the bottom where there is the -Soundpool and -Keyboard section, in MM12 there was also an option for seeing my files, but in MMMX there is only the 2 choises I named. HELP!

wt_watch wrote on 3/15/2012, 11:29 PM

I have found my problem!!! Easy mode has to be turned off, then my files appear down in "File manager"

I wonder if I spent money on that mp2 enabler codex for nothing? I don't even know what it's for anyway!

Procyon wrote on 3/16/2012, 5:46 AM

Congratulations!  It isn't often people solve their own problems before we can help.

The MP3 codex you purchased allows you to convert an unlimited number of projects to the MP3 format. (Very handy to have.) The program comes with only a limited number of free conversions.
